Day 108: Vancouver to Friday Harbor

We’re back in Washington today. Crossing the Strait of Georgia was pretty rough and unpleasant. I’m not sure if we misread the forecast or just had a tide-wind conflict that whipped up the water, but the poor boat (and her passengers) got a pounding. When we got to the other side of the strait, we anchored in Lyall Harbour on Saturna Island to settle down, have a late lunch, and check the boat for things that might have been affected by the rough crossing.


After that it was a short hop planing to the border and across to Friday Harbor. We used the CBP Roam app again for a painless remote customs experience. We did have to stop by the customs dock in Friday Harbor to surrender our Canadian eggs, but we were planning to stop for the night there anyway, so that wasn’t a problem.


Friday Harbor Waterfront

It was a beautiful evening on San Juan Island. After anchoring, we walked up to San Juan Brewing Company for a couple beers and a pizza before returning to our anchorage to catch up with blog posts (me) and relax in the sun (Ryan) before bed.
